OT Cybersecurity Risk & Compliance Specialist
Job Description An employer in the Galleria area of Houston, Texas is looking for an OT Cybersecurity Risk & Compliance Specialist. This role supports cybersecurity risk and compliance efforts across the America region, focusing on technical risk, human risk, and regulatory risk. The analyst will design and evaluate controls, track evolving regulations, and review technical solutions to ensure alignment with internal standards and external compliance requirements. On a daily basis this person will review and assess solution designs for cybersecurity risks (e.g., firewalls, networking, IAM, cloud exposure); manage operational tasks via ServiceNow (e.g., firewall change reviews); conduct project-based risk assessments and regulatory tracking (e.g., Texas and Louisiana regulations); interpret and apply compliance frameworks (HIPAA, GDPR, TSA, FEMSA, maritime cybersecurity); and collaborate with adjacent teams in operations, IT, and cyber delivery. Lastly, they must be OK sitting onsite 3-4 days a week. This position pays between $80-90/hr depending on skillset and experience.
